Output 3449946c1c76b1a8948745b6f21f84832aba74d5702361f2f611629b9025f6a4:3

value
252157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ed95141e0c76e16c5e1b4688ee16606d71270b38 OP_EQUAL
address
3PMEfAmE8nNH3tsWPKzpsbqzWnpafRfuNN
transaction
3449946c1c76b1a8948745b6f21f84832aba74d5702361f2f611629b9025f6a4